Primary immunodeficiency or monogenic inflammatory bowel disease v7.4 TET2 Arina Puzriakova Added comment: Comment on list classification: Total of at least 4 unrelated cases reported to date with an immune dysregulation syndrome and lymphoproliferation (PMIDs: 32518946; 36066697). Sufficient to promote this gene to green with biallelic MOI (3 cases) but not monoallelic (1 case) - possible that in trans variant was missed or the heterozygous variant in LRBA additionally detected in this individual acted as a phenotype-modifier.

Primary immunodeficiency or monogenic inflammatory bowel disease v2.187 TET2 Arina Puzriakova changed review comment from: PMID: 32518946 (2020) - Three cases from two unrelated consanguineous families with immunodeficiency and lymphoproliferative disease, associated with homozygous variants (c.4145A>G, p.H1382R and c.4894C>T,
p.Q1632*) in the TET2 gene. Molecular studies showed that the variants result in altered DNA methylation and B-cell maturation, as well as skewed T-cell differentiation and hematopoiesis.; to: PMID: 32518946 (2020) - Three cases from two unrelated consanguineous families with immunodeficiency and lymphoproliferative disease, associated with homozygous variants (c.4145A>G, p.H1382R and c.4894C>T, p.Q1632*) in the TET2 gene. Molecular studies showed that the variants result in altered DNA methylation and B-cell maturation, as well as skewed T-cell differentiation and hematopoiesis.
